The National Monuments Service's description

In rough pasture, on a rise on a W-facing hillslope overlooking Glengarriff Harbour and within a network of relict field boundaries (CO091-016001-). The remains of an oval hut site (3.6m NE-SW; 2m NW-SE) defined by stones, the tops of which protrude intermittently from a low peaty bank (Wth 0.7m; H 0.2m). The level interior is in pasture. A fulacht fia (CO091-016005-) is c. 45m to the E.

The above description is derived from 'The Archaeological Inventory of County Cork. Volume 5' (Dublin: Stationery Office, 2009).
